1. Phenomenological Studies on Supersymmetry and the Strong Force
Abstract : In this thesis, we first consider the phenomenology of R-parity violating supersymmetric extensions of the Standard Model. Specifically, a large number of Lepton and Baryon Number violating decays of sparticles to particles are implemented in the Pythia event generator. READ MORE

2. The Complex World of Superstrings : On Semichiral Sigma Models and N=(4,4) Supersymmetry
Abstract : Non-linear sigma models with extended supersymmetry have constrained target space geometries, and can serve as effective tools for investigating and constructing new geometries. Analyzing the geometrical and topological properties of sigma models is necessary to understand the underlying structures of string theory. READ MORE

3. Strings, Branes and Symmetries
Abstract : Recent dramatic progress in the understanding of the non-perturbative structure of superstring theory shows that extended objects of various kinds, collectively referred to as p-branes, are an integral part of the theory. In this thesis, comprising an introductory text divided in two parts and seven appended research papers (Papers I-VII), we study various aspects of p-branes with relevance for superstring theory. 4. Off-shell, maximal supersymmetry & exceptional geometry
Abstract : Two lines of research are presented in this thesis, both with a focus on fundamental properties within the supersymmetric theories of high energy physics. The first features analyses based on the actions for maximal supersymmetric Yang–Mills theory and supergravity, provided by the pure spinor formalism. READ MORE
